Egress window installation involves adding large, accessible windows to basement or lower-level spaces to meet safety and building code requirements. This service typically includes removing sections of foundation walls, creating an opening that meets size and height specifications, and installing a window that provides an emergency escape route. The process often requires precise framing, waterproofing, and finishing to ensure the window is secure, functional, and compliant with local regulations. Professional contractors focus on proper installation techniques to prevent issues such as leaks, structural damage, or inadequate escape routes.
This service addresses critical safety concerns by providing a means of egress in basement areas that may otherwise lack sufficient exits. It is particularly valuable in emergency situations, allowing occupants to evacuate quickly and safely. Additionally, egress windows can improve natural light and ventilation in basement spaces, making them more livable and reducing reliance on artificial lighting. Proper installation also helps prevent moisture intrusion and mold growth, which can be common problems in below-grade spaces lacking adequate drainage or sealing.

Material and Window Costs - The cost for egress windows typically ranges from $1,500 to $3,500, including materials and the window itself. Prices vary based on window size, type, and material choices. For example, a standard-sized window might cost around $2,000 installed.
Labor and Installation Fees - Installation services generally cost between $1,000 and $2,500, depending on the complexity of the project. Factors such as foundation type and accessibility can influence labor costs.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ific home conditions.
Permitting and Inspection Expenses - Permitting fees for egress window installation typically range from $100 to $500, depending on local regulations. Some areas require inspections, which may incur additional charges. Contact local service providers to understand permit requirements and costs.
Total Project Cost Range - Overall, the complete cost for installing an egress window usually falls between $2,500 and $6,000. This range accounts for materials, labor, permits, and possible site-specific adjustments. Prices can vary based on project scope and location specifics.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is an egress window? An egress window is a large window designed to provide an emergency exit in basements or bedrooms, enhancing safety and compliance with building codes.
Why should I consider installing an egress window? Installing an egress window can improve safety by providing a means of escape during emergencies and can also increase natural light and ventilation in basement areas.
How long does egress window installation typically take? The installation duration varies depending on the project scope and home structure, but local contractors can provide estimates after assessments.
Are there different types of egress windows available? Yes, options include casement, double-hung, and sliding styles, allowing homeowners to choose based on aesthetic preferences and space considerations.
What should I consider before installing an egress window? It’s important to evaluate local building codes, basement layout, and drainage considerations, and to consult with local service providers for guidance.
